Leigh AnnLeigh Ann
This is a very cosy place. It's great if you just want a place to sleep on your travels. The beds are very comfortable, everything is very clean, it's family owned and it shows in the attention to detail. I wouldn't suggest this place to solo travelers who want to meet people in a social environment, just because the communal areas are quite small and so is the hostel. Good place to recover for a couple nights though.

This place was wonderful; it was well run and very clean. The location was great (only about 5 minutes walk to the river and public transport such as trains and buses). Being back off the main roads meant that it was also pretty quiet.||The owner was lovely, speaks great english and was full of knowledge and helpful tips to help guests enjoy their stay. I was of the impression that it is family run; the owner's(?) family and kids would frequently be seen downstairs and out front, which I found to be quite charming.||The private room was fairly small (the ensuite was well sized however) but had a very large wardrobe and storage space; it would be well suited to solo travellers and well organised couples. The room was cleaned daily, and as far as I could tell the cleanliness was very good.||The only thing I'd note (and this is subjective, as it may be an issue for some but not others) is that it's not a particularly social place. It's absolutely fine if you're looking for a peaceful and laid back stay, but if you're looking for socialisation or a party hostel, this is probably not the...
